8" barrel in .44 percussion caliber. Manufactured 1864. This fine Colt Model 1860 Army remains in excellent, all original, condition with all matching numbers including the wedge. Standard features include; blued 8" barrel, blued six shot rebated percussion cylinder, blued steel back strap, brass trigger guard with case colored frame, hammer and lever. The barrel retains flashes of brilliant blue in recesses but is basically a soft grey-brown patina with some light age freckling. The cylinder retains 70% original factory blue on the rebated area. Has a beautiful Naval battle etched scene. Back strap has brilliant blue at top strap. Frame retains traces of original case colors but has basically greyed out. Original varnished walnut grips are near mint, retaining most of their original finish. All legends are perfect. Screw heads are untouched. Traces of case colors on loading lever. An extremely nice, clean and all matching 1860 Army.
